解决Shadowsocks IPv4无效问题的完整指南

引言

在如今的信息时代,网络安全和隐私保护显得尤为重要。很多用户选择使用 Shadowsocks 来实现科学上网,然而,在使用过程中,有些用户会遇到 IPv4无效 的问题。本文将详细分析这一问题的成因,并提供相应的解决方案。

什么是Shadowsocks?

Shadowsocks 是一种安全的代理工具,通常用于翻墙和保护网络隐私。它采用了轻量级的代理协议,允许用户通过隧道连接来绕过网络限制。

Shadowsocks的工作原理

Shadowsocks 通过以下步骤进行工作:

  1. 客户端通过加密的方式将数据发送至服务器。
  2. 服务器解密数据,并将其转发至目标网站。
  3. 返回的数据经过加密后,再传回客户端。

IPv4无效问题的概述

IPv4无效 通常指的是在使用 Shadowsocks 时,客户端无法正常连接至服务器或访问特定的网络资源。这一问题可能源于多个因素,以下是一些常见的原因:

  • 网络配置问题:网络设置错误可能导致IP地址无法正常工作。
  • 服务器问题:如果 Shadowsocks 服务器出现故障,也可能导致连接失败。
  • 防火墙设置:本地或ISP的防火墙可能会阻止 Shadowsocks 的连接。
  • 协议不匹配:使用不支持的协议类型也会导致无效的IPv4连接。

IPv4无效的常见原因

1. 网络配置问题

当你的网络设置不正确时,可能会出现 IPv4无效 的情况。

  • 确认网络连接是否正常。
  • 检查 Shadowsocks 客户端的设置,确保IP地址和端口号正确。

2. 服务器问题

有时,连接的问题可能出在服务器端。

  • 确认服务器是否在线,并正常运行。
  • 尝试使用不同的服务器以确定是否为特定服务器的问题。

3. 防火墙设置

防火墙会阻止某些连接,导致 IPv4无效

  • 检查本地防火墙设置,确保允许 Shadowsocks 的通信。
  • 与ISP联系,确认他们是否在阻止代理流量。

4. 协议不匹配

使用不支持的协议类型可能会导致连接问题。

  • 确认客户端和服务器的协议设置一致。

解决Shadowsocks IPv4无效问题的步骤

步骤1:检查网络连接

首先,确保你的网络连接正常。可以通过访问其他网站测试网络是否正常。

步骤2:验证Shadowsocks设置

  • 检查 Shadowsocks 客户端的配置:确保IP地址、端口、加密方式等信息输入正确。
  • 更新客户端至最新版本以修复潜在的Bug。

步骤3:更换服务器

尝试连接到其他服务器,以确定问题是否出在特定服务器。

步骤4:检查防火墙设置

  • 禁用防火墙,测试 Shadowsocks 是否能够正常工作。
  • 如果能够正常工作,添加 Shadowsocks 到防火墙的白名单。

步骤5:使用命令行测试

使用命令行工具(如 pingtraceroute)来检测与 Shadowsocks 服务器之间的连接情况。

FAQ

Shadowsocks IPv4无效是什么原因?

IPv4无效 可能是由网络配置错误、服务器问题、防火墙限制或协议不匹配引起的。

如何修复Shadowsocks IPv4无效的问题?

  • 检查网络连接是否正常。
  • 确保 Shadowsocks 客户端的配置正确。
  • 更换不同的服务器。
  • 检查防火墙设置,确保允许 Shadowsocks 的连接。

Shadowsocks的最佳使用方法是什么?

  • 使用最新版本的 Shadowsocks 客户端。
  • 配置多条备份服务器。
  • 定期检查和更新配置。

如何选择适合的Shadowsocks服务器?

选择具有良好稳定性和速度的服务器,查看用户评价以及延迟情况,尽量选择地理位置靠近的服务器。

结论

在使用 Shadowsocks 的过程中,遇到 IPv4无效 的问题并不罕见。通过正确的排查和设置,用户通常能够快速解决这些问题。希望本文能帮助您更好地使用 Shadowsocks,畅享安全和自由的网络环境。

正文完